Ok, I've noticed something else (don't flame me if I'm blatantly wrong through ;-) )

When I load dirty uin A ('dirty' as in : with the ad window attached) each time I open a message window (double click 
on user in contactlist, pick message from menu etc..), icqateb.ocx is run, as well as icqateres.dll, imm32.dll, 
icqate32.dll and olepro32.dll.
From then on, each time a message window is opened only icqate32.dll, imm32.dll and icqateres.dll are run.

Then I load clean uin B (this is the part I'm not so sure of) and it looks like the libraries I mentioned above 
aren't loaded.... Anyway, I'm just mentioning it, personally I don't believe this to be true. It's just general 
lameness on the matter from my side.
